Description

Bio-Vitroceramic Ap40 is a specialized bioactive glass-ceramic material designed for advanced industrial and biomedical applications. Its unique composition and structure provide exceptional biocompatibility, bioactivity, and controlled ion release properties, making it a critical component for next-generation materials. This product is essential for manufacturers and researchers in the medical device, dental, and advanced ceramics sectors seeking to enhance product performance and integration with biological systems.

Application

  • Medical Implants and Bone Grafts: As a bioactive scaffold for bone regeneration and as a coating for orthopedic and dental implants to promote osseointegration.
  • Dental Restoratives and Cements: Used in bioactive dental composites, liners, and restorative materials for its remineralization potential.
  • Tissue Engineering: Serves as a porous matrix or filler in engineered constructs for hard tissue repair and regeneration.
  • Wound Healing and Dermatology: Incorporated into advanced wound dressings and hemostatic agents to support tissue repair.
  • Cosmetic and Personal Care: Utilized in premium skincare formulations for its purported bioactive and remineralizing effects.
  • Advanced Ceramics and Composites: Acts as a functional filler or matrix material to impart bioactivity and specific mechanical properties to ceramic composites.
  • Drug Delivery Systems: Engineered as a carrier for controlled local release of therapeutic ions or pharmaceutical agents.
  • Research and Development: A key material for academic and industrial R&D in biomaterials science and bioactive ceramics.

Storage

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Store in a cool, dry, and well-ventilated area at a controlled room temperature (15-25°C). This material is hygroscopic (moisture-sensitive); ensure the container is sealed after each use to prevent moisture uptake, which can affect flow properties and bioactivity.
